Driver of 24 years is Virginia’s trucking grand champion

Mark Brundage (Image Courtesy of Virginia Trucking Association)Mark Brundage (Image Courtesy of Virginia Trucking Association)

FedEx Express driver Mark Brundage, from Leesburg, had the highest score of all 94 competitors at the Virginia Truck Driving Championships June 16-17 at Wytheville Community College, making him the state’s grand champion.

Brundage has been a trucker for 24 years and has driven 1.5 million safe miles. He has spent 16 out of his 24 years in the industry driving for FedEx Express.

The winners, by category, were:

Neill Darmstadter Memorial Grand Champion Award: Mark Brundage, FedEx Express 

Willie Taylor Memorial Course Champion Award: Thomas Tascone, Walmart Transportation

Captain Roy Terry Memorial Pre-Trip Inspection Award: Kenneth Cook, Walmart Transportation

Rookie of the Year Award: Tony Myrtle, FedEx Freight

Team Trophy: ABF Freight System

Step Van: Christopher Brown, FedEx Express

Straight Truck: Dan Wilson, Frito-Lay

3-Axle: Thomas Tascone, Walmart Transportation

4-Axle: Mark Brundage, FedEx Express

5-Axle Van: Kenneth Cook, Walmart Transportation

Flatbed: Joe Clements, UPS Freight

Tank: Anthony Cottrell, XPO Logistics

Sleeper Berth: Mike Barnes, Walmart Transportation

Twin Trailers: Chuck Bird, FedEx Freight
